Vehicle Summary
The 2008 Porsche Cayenne Turbo is a powerful SUV featuring a 4.8-liter V8 engine that delivers 500 horsepower. Designed and manufactured in Leipzig, Germany, this model boasts a robust build with a Gross Vehicle Weight Rating of up to 6,790 pounds. With its elegant design, four-door configuration, and advanced safety features like a passive restraint system and direct TPMS, the Cayenne Turbo combines luxury with performance.

Common Issues for This Vehicle
Oil leaks
The 2008 Porsche Cayenne is prone to oil leaks, often from the valve cover gaskets, oil pan, or rear main seal, which can cause significant engine damage if not addressed.
Coolant pipe failure
The plastic coolant pipes in the 2008 Porsche Cayenne often fail, leading to coolant leaks and potential overheating issues.
Ignition coil failure
The ignition coils in the 2008 Porsche Cayenne can fail, causing misfires, poor engine performance, and reduced fuel efficiency.
Timing chain issues
Timing chain problems, including tensioner or guide failure, can occur in the Porsche Cayenne, leading to rattling noises and potential engine damage if the chain skips.
Pcv valve failure
The Positive Crankcase Ventilation (PCV) valve can fail, causing rough idling, poor fuel economy, and increased oil consumption.
Carbon build-up
Direct injection engines in the 2008 Porsche Cayenne can suffer from carbon build-up on intake valves, leading to reduced engine performance and efficiency.
